Area contextNeighborhood Overview – National Cattle Congress Grounds Arena (Waterloo, IA)
The National Cattle Congress Grounds Arena is situated on the eastern edge of Waterloo, Iowa, offering a unique blend of rural and urban accessibility. Located off Ansborough Avenue, it’s a prominent landmark easily reachable from major routes like US-218 and Interstate 380. These highways provide direct access to Cedar Rapids to the south and connect to further destinations north and west, making travel to and from the grounds straightforward. Parking is generally ample on-site, with specific lot designations often communicated based on the event schedule. For those arriving by air, Waterloo Regional Airport (ALO) is the closest, typically a short 10-15 minute drive away. Rideshare services and taxis are available from the airport and throughout Waterloo, offering convenient options for reaching the grounds without a personal vehicle. Event-specific traffic advisories are common, so monitoring local news or event communications is advised for the smoothest arrival, especially during peak times like the annual National Cattle Congress. Arriving 30-45 minutes before an event's official start is usually recommended to account for parking and entry procedures.

Things to Do Near National Cattle Congress Grounds Arena
Walkable
Waterloo Center for the Arts
Discover a vibrant collection of art, including significant pieces of American realism and decorative arts. The center often hosts rotating exhibitions, workshops, and community events, making it a dynamic cultural stop. Its location along the Cedar River offers pleasant views and a connection to the city's downtown revitalization efforts. Admission is typically free, encouraging widespread community engagement with the arts.

Weather & Seasons at National Cattle Congress Grounds Arena
- Winter: Winter in Waterloo brings cold temperatures, with average highs in the 20s and 30s Fahrenheit. Bundle up in heavy coats, hats, and gloves for any outdoor activities. Indoor events are common, but travel to and from the grounds may require navigating icy conditions. Check road conditions before departing.
- Spring & early summer: Spring offers gradually warming temperatures, ranging from the 40s to 60s Fahrenheit. Expect variable weather with a chance of rain. Light to medium jackets are advisable, and waterproof footwear is a good idea. Outdoor events begin to pick up, but days can still feel cool, especially in the mornings and evenings.
- Mid-summer: Summers are typically warm to hot, with temperatures often reaching the 70s and 80s Fahrenheit, sometimes higher. Lightweight clothing, sunscreen, and hats are essential for comfort during outdoor events. Stay hydrated, as humidity can make the heat feel more intense. Evening events might require a light layer.
- Fall season: Fall brings crisp air and cooling temperatures, generally ranging from the 50s to 70s Fahrenheit early on, dropping into the 30s and 40s by late fall. Layers are key, with jackets, sweaters, and long sleeves recommended. The grounds are beautiful during this season, but cooler evenings call for warmer attire.
- Rain & snow: Rain is possible throughout the year, so carrying an umbrella or light rain jacket is always a practical precaution. Snow typically falls from late November through March. Winter precipitation can impact travel and event access, so staying informed about weather advisories is crucial during colder months. Indoor facilities offer shelter during inclement weather.
